As a Hunter Ed Instructor and a Complier for the CBC, I highly recommend to
wear the minimum of a vest, the hat is not enough. The more visible you are
the safer you will be.  Be courteous to the hunters, they have as much right
to be there as we birders and we all must share the spaces we have left.
Many of the places we look for birds are there because of Wildlife
Management Programs and are either paid for or supported by Sportsman and
Conservation Groups.

Blaze Orange anyone? "Ohio hunters and birdwatchers are reminded that they
will need to be aware of one another as they pursue deer and birds on this
shared weekend. Hunters need to remember that there may be other
people&mdash;both hunters and non-hunters&mdash; in the woods. Birders are
also reminded that hunters are allowed to hunt wherever they have written
permission to hunt. And, while hunters are required to wear hunter orange in
the field, birders should consider wearing a hunter orange vest or hat
during the deer-gun weekend." Happy Snow Day- don't forget the little ones
